General hints
Note
● Always actuate the operation
switch until the acoustic signal
sounds or the hazard warning
flashers illuminate, to ensure that
the soft top is completely opened
or closed.
● The soft top can be held in an
intermediate position to facilitate
cleaning of hood spaces and
gaskets. Release the switch in
the centre console during
operation to stop soft top
movement in intermediate
position for a maximum of
7 minutes when ignition is on.
After this time a warning chime
sounds, the hydraulic pressure in
the system decreases and the
soft top can start to move by
itself.
● Do not open the soft top if it is wet,
frozen or dirty.
● Activating the soft top on uneven
ground can lead to malfunctions
and damage.

Instruction closing in the event of a
system fault
In case of malfunction of the electro-
hydraulic actuation, the opened soft
top can be closed instructionly.
A warning chime sounds and a
message appears in the Driver
Information Centre.
Caution
We strongly advise performing
instruction closing of the soft top with
two persons.
Instruction operation of the soft top is
permitted only for closing.
Read the following description
completely before starting to
operate.
Do not perform the instruction closing
with the vehicle parked on
downhill gradient or inclines.
Remove the large wind deflector
before starting to operate.
After closing, have the soft top
repaired by a workshop.
Prepare the following tools which are
required for instruction operation:
● allen key with 4 mm hexagon on
the long side and 6 mm hexagon
on the short side, located in the
glovebox
● two strings, located in the
glovebox
● screwdriver, located in the tool
box in the load compartment
1. Switch off ignition.
2. Open the boot lid and remove the
screwdriver from the tool box.

3. On the inside of the upper load
compartment edge is a lever for
releasing the soft top lid. Locate
the lever and unlatch by swivelling
the lever downwards.
Note
The boot lid cannot be opened from
next step on.
Remove the screwdriver from the
toolbox for further operation. It is
possible that the load compartment
cannot be opened until the vehicle is
at a workshop. Therefore remove
any required objects from the load
compartment.
4. Close boot lid.
5. Lift up soft top lid from both sides
simultaneously up to approx. the
half raised position.
6. Insert the 4 mm Allen key into the
marked position of the flap-drive
unit. Turn the Allen key clockwise
all the way to the stop, so that the
sideways flaps are swivelled in.
7. Open the soft top lid to its end
position.
8. Remove plastic covers on both
sides by pushing and sliding
backwards, see illustration.
9. At the hinges on each side there
are visible marks.

10. Haul in the attached strings
around the marked position at the
hinge on both sides and pull the
end of the string through the loop,
as shown in the illustration.
11. Deposit the end of the strings at
the front.
12. Pull out the soft top by lifting up the
front bow (1) and simultaneously
the tension bow (2) on both sides.
13. Move the front bow (1) to the
windscreen frame.
14. Remove the small lid in the
windscreen frame trim using a
screwdriver which is inserted in
the recess of the lid.
15. Insert the 6 mm Allen key into the
closure and lock the latch by
turning the Allen key clockwise to
its end position.

16. Lift up the tension bow (2) of the
soft top on both sides. Raise up
soft top lid by pushing slowly
approx. to the half raised position
and then let it slide into the closed
position.
17. Lower the tension bow (2) of the
soft top.
Note
In this position, the vehicle can be
driven to a workshop for soft top
overhaul. The soft top is not
completely waterproof and not
latched at the rear.
To latch the soft top completely,
execute the following step.
18. Push down firmly each side of the
tension bow. Simultaneously pull
the string with a screwdriver cross
in the loop slowly and continuous
to the front. Possibly support
yourself on the door frame with
the other hand. Execute this on
both sides to latch the soft top at
the rear.
After the last step, the boot lid can be
opened again. Allow the strings to be
removed by your workshop.
The soft top may not be opened with
fixed strings.
Wind deflector
There are two wind deflectors located
in a bag behind the rear seat
backrests. Fold down the rear
backrests 3 72, open the Velcro
fasteners and move out the bag from
the recess.
● The small wind deflector can be
placed between the rear head
restraints.
● The big wind deflector can be
placed behind the front seats.
Do not place any objects on the wind
deflector.

To install the deflectors, the soft top
should be opened.
Fitting of the small wind deflector
● Fold down left rear backrest
● Remove the cover from the
guidance between the rear head
restraints by sliding sideways to
the left vehicle side.
● Insert the adapter of the deflector
with the elevation into the
opposite recess of the guidance.
● Slide deflector in the guidance to
the right vehicle side until it
engages.
● Raise rear backrest.
Remove deflector in reverse order.
Fitting of the big wind deflector
● Take the deflector out of the bag.
● Extract the four locking pins of
the deflector: the upper ones leap
out spring-loaded by turning the
pins out of the brackets on both
sides, the lower ones leap out by
lifting the detents at the sliders on
both sides.
● Expand the wind deflector.

● With the hinges behind the front
seats insert the right side locking
pins in the recesses of the right
side trim near the rear seat. Fold
the deflector a little at the centre
and insert the left side locking
pins in the recesses of the left
side trim. Ensure that all pins are
properly engaged. Push down
the deflector at the centre.
● Fold up the upper part to vertical
position.
The rear seats cannot be occupied
when the big wind deflector is
mounted.
The vertical part of the deflector can
be folded down when not used.
Wind deflector may remain mounted
when the soft top is closed.
For removing fold down vertical part
of the deflector. Lift up the deflector at
the centre a little and remove it from
the recesses on both sides.
Stowing the wind deflector
To stow the deflector, move in the
rear locking pins by pushing back and
turning the pins into the brackets.
Push back the sliders of the front
locking pins until they engage. Swing
in the deflector and stow it in the bag.
Fold down the rear backrests. Align
the hard cover of the bag to the load
compartment. Position the bag from
the bottom up at the lateral guide in
the recess of the upper frame. Fix the
bag with the Velcro fastener at the
lashing eyes on both sides. Raise
rear backrests.

Rollover protection system
The rollover protection system
consists of a reinforced windscreen
frame and roll bars under covers
behind the rear head restraints.
In the event of a vehicle rollover,
head-on collision or side impact, the
roll bars deploy upwards
automatically within milliseconds.
They also deploy together with the
front and side airbag systems.
Note
Do not place any objects on the
covers of the roll bars behind the
head restraints.
The airbag control indicator v
illuminates if the roll bars have been
deployed.
The system deploys with the soft top
opened or closed.
The soft top must not be operated if
the roll bars have been deployed. A
continuous warning will sound and a
message appears in the Driver
Information Centre if the switch is
actuated.

Head restraints
Position
9 Warning
Only drive with the head restraint
set to the proper position.
The upper edge of the head restraint
should be at upper head level. If this
is not possible for extremely tall
people, set to highest position, and
set to lowest position for small people.
Adjustment
Head restraints on front seats
Height adjustment
Press release button, adjust height,
engage.

Horizontal adjustment
Pull bolster of head restraint forwards
slowly. It engages in several
positions.
To return to its rearmost position, pull
fully forwards and release.
Head restraints on rear seats
Height adjustment
Pull the head restraint upwards and
let engage. To move downwards,
press the catch to release and push
the head restraint downwards.
Removal of rear head restraint
E.g. when using a child restraint
Press both catches, pull the head
restraint upwards and remove.
Place the head restraint in a net bag
and secure the underside of the bag
with the Velcro fasteners on the load
compartment floor. A suitable net bag
is available at your workshop.
Active head restraints
In the event of a rear-end impact, the
front parts of the active head
restraints are moved slightly
forwards. Thus the head is supported
so that the risk of whiplash injury is
reduced.

Front seats
Seat position
9 Warning
Only drive with the seat correctly
adjusted.
9 Danger
Do not sit nearer than 25 cm from
the steering wheel, to permit safe
airbag deployment.
9 Warning
Never adjust seats while driving as
they could move uncontrollably.
9 Warning
Never store any objects under the
seats.
● Sit with buttocks as far back
against the backrest as possible.
Adjust the distance between the
seat and the pedals so that legs
are slightly angled when pressing
the pedals. Slide the front
passenger seat as far back as
possible.
● Set seat height high enough to
have a clear field of vision on all
sides and of all display
instruments. There should be at
least one hand of clearance
between head and the roof
frame. Your thighs should rest
lightly on the seat without
pressing into it.
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Seats, restraints
49
● Sit with shoulders as far back
against the backrest as possible.
Set the backrest rake so that it is
possible to easily reach the
steering wheel with arms slightly
bent. Maintain contact between
shoulders and the backrest when
turning the steering wheel. Do
not angle the backrest too far
back. We recommend a
maximum rake of approx. 25°.
● Adjust seat and steering wheel in
a way that the wrist rests on top
of the steering wheel while the
arm is fully extended and
shoulders on the backrest.
● Adjust the steering wheel 3 78.
● Adjust the head restraint 3 46.
● Adjust the thigh support so that
there is a space approx. two
fingers wide between the edge of
the seat and the hollow of the
knee.
● Adjust the lumbar support so that
it supports the natural shape of
the spine.
Instruction seat adjustment
Drive only with engaged seats and
backrests.
Longitudinal adjustment
Pull handle, slide seat, release
handle. Try to move the seat back and
forth to ensure that the seat is locked
in place.
Backrest inclination
Turn lever to the rear, adjust
inclination and release lever. Allow
the backrest to engage audibly.

Adjustable thigh support
Pull the lever and slide the thigh
support.
Seat folding
9 Warning
Passengers on rear seats should
take care not to be trapped by the
adjustment mechanism when the
seat moves back to its original
position.
Caution
When seat height is in highest
position, push head restraints
down and lift up sun visors before
folding backrest forwards.
Seat folding on instruction operated
seats
Lift release lever and fold backrest
forwards, then slide seat forwards to
the stop.
To restore, slide the seat backwards
to the stop. Lift backrest to upright
position without operating any lever.
Ensure backrest engages.
9
Warning
When folding up, ensure that the
seat is securely locked in position
before driving. Failure to do so
may result in personal injury in the
event of hard braking or collision.
When fully engaged the seat will be in
original position again.
Do not operate backrest inclination
lever while backrest is folded forward.

Lift release lever and fold backrest
forwards. The seat slides
automatically forwards to the stop.
To restore, lift backrest to upright
position and engage. The seat slides
automatically backwards to the
original position.
In case the head restraint of the
folded backrest is blocked by the
upper windscreen frame, allow the
seat to move backwards or
downwards slightly 3 52, or set
head restraint to lowest position
Safety function
If the power seat encounters
resistance while sliding forwards or
rearwards, it is immediately stopped
and moved in the opposite direction.
Note
Do not sit on the seat while seat is
moving.
Power disconnection
If seat remains in forward position
with opened door for more than
10 minutes, power adjustment is
disconnected. In this event, close and
open the door or switch on ignition
and operate power adjustment again.
Overload
If the folding function is electrically
overloaded, the power supply is
automatically cut-off for a short time.
